From d772e46667bb79a22205a7f6533b11e37630e1ef Mon Sep 17 00:00:00 2001 From: Malte Poll Date: Wed, 23 Mar 2022 11:23:10 +0100 Subject: [PATCH] Use parallel gzip implementation (pigz) to repack GCP image after recalculating dm-verity hashtree (#1) --- images/fcos/dm-verity/recalculate-dm-verity.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/images/fcos/dm-verity/recalculate-dm-verity.sh b/images/fcos/dm-verity/recalculate-dm-verity.sh index 48cf60294..eee1fb44b 100755 --- a/images/fcos/dm-verity/recalculate-dm-verity.sh +++ b/images/fcos/dm-verity/recalculate-dm-verity.sh @@ -163,7 +163,7 @@ repack () { gcp) echo "📥 Repacking GCP image..." - tar --owner=0 --group=0 -C "${unpacked_image_dir}" -Sch --format=oldgnu -f "${tmp_tar_file}" "${unpacked_image_filename}" + tar --use-compress-program=pigz --owner=0 --group=0 -C "${unpacked_image_dir}" -Sch --format=oldgnu -f "${tmp_tar_file}" "${unpacked_image_filename}" "${PV}" "${tmp_tar_file}" | gzip -9c > "${packed_image}" rm "${tmp_tar_file}" echo " Repacked image stored in ${packed_image}"